Common Charging Flex Issues and How to Troubleshoot Them

Charging flex cables are an essential component of all portable electronic devices such as smartphones, tablets, and laptops. These cables are designed to connect the charging port of your device to the mainboard, which enables the device to charge its battery. In most cases, charging flex cables are built to last but sometimes, they might develop problems. Here are the common charging flex issues and how to troubleshoot them.

1. Charging Flex Not Responding

The most common issue with charging flex cables is when they stop responding or no longer work. This can be due to several factors such as a loose connection or a damaged cable. In most cases, the best solution is to replace the charging flex cable. However, before you do that, you can try to check if the problem is coming from the charging port or the power source such as a damaged charger. Sometimes, the charging port may need cleaning to remove any debris or dirt that may be blocking a proper connection. You can use a toothbrush to clean the port gently.

2. Overheating

Another common issue with charging flex cables is overheating. If your charging flex cable overheats, it is most likely due to an electrical fault in the cable. In such cases, it is recommended that you stop using the cable immediately and have it replaced. Overheating can cause permanent damage to your device, which may lead to complex and costly repairs.

3. Slow Charging

If you notice that your device is taking longer than usual to charge, the problem may lie with the charging flex cable. This can happen due to a damaged or faulty cable or a weak power source. To troubleshoot this issue, you should first try to use a different charger or power source to see if that helps. If the problem persists, try to replace the charging flex cable.

4. Broken Wires

Another common issue with charging flex cables is broken wires. This can happen due to regular wear and tear or as a result of physical damage to the cable. Broken wires can prevent your device from charging properly or cause intermittent charging problems. To fix this issue, you can use a multimeter to test the continuity of the charging flex cable's wires. If you find any broken or damaged wires, you will need to replace the charging flex cable.

5. False Detection

Sometimes, your device may indicate that it is charging when it is actually not. This false detection issue can be due to a dirty charging port, a loose connection, or a damaged charging flex cable. To resolve this issue, you should clean the charging port and try to reconnect the charging flex cable. If that doesn't work, try using a different charger. If none of these steps work, you may need to replace the charging flex cable.

In summary, charging flex cables are essential components of portable electronic devices. If you experience any of the issues discussed above, you should try to troubleshoot the problem or consult a professional technician. By understanding these common issues and how to troubleshoot them, you can ensure that your device remains fully charged and operational for longer.
